最新消息:请大家多多支持

Ios App Development Using Swift With Ios Mobile App Projects

教程/Tutorials dsgsd 82浏览 0评论

Published 1/2024
MP4 | Video: h264, 1920×1080 | Audio: AAC, 44.1 KHz
Language: English | Size: 2.04 GB | Duration: 5h 13m

SwiftUI with Xcode, CoreData, Firebase, API Integration, TestFlight, App Store and multiple real iOS Mobile App Projects

What you’ll learn
You will develop multiple iOS apps (such as Space Flight News app, Meeting Notes app, Realtime Photo Gallery & Sharing app, etc.)
You will understand Swift and SwiftUI for modern app development following Apple’s guidelines
You will work with modern Apple technologies such as CoreData, Video players, API Integration and Firebase
You will understand how to build from scratch to archive and release apps on TestFlight and App Store

Requirements
No programming experience is necessary – I shall guide you from scratch to release on the App Store.
A macOS running computer or laptop is required

Description
Welcome to the latest iOS mobile app development course “iOS App Development using Swift with iOS Mobile App Projects”.From Beginner to iOS Developer with one course – this course is the latest and updated course on iOS app development as it shows you how to develop efficient iOS apps using Apple’s modern framework SwiftUI tested on iOS versions 16 and 17 with several live projects. By the end of this course, you will have your portfolio of your own apps by developing iOS app projects, including: Space Flight News iOS app, Meeting Notes iOS app, Realtime Photo Gallery & Sharing iOS app etc.And you will easily be able to implement:1. Swift Programming Language (History, Data Types, Variables, Functions, Guard, Conditionals and more with live examples)2. Xcode: Get hands-on Xcode options to build, archive and upload iOS apps to App Store & TestFlight3. Comparative study of UIKit and SwiftUI: Features, advantages & Examples of both4. Developing UI screens: Splash screen, TextField, Menu, VStack, HStack, ZStack, Spacing and other widgets5. Designing screens: Using images (offline and online both), video player (offline and online both), foreground & background colors, buttons with events & actions6. APIs: Understanding how APIs function and hands-on experience with free software such as Postman, Quicktype etc.7. Integrating APIs into iOS apps: Using Unsplash API, Space Flight API etc.8. Firebase: Exploring, integrating and configuring Google Firebase into iOS apps9. Offline Storage: Developing iOS app using CoreData to add, save and delete data without internet10. Swift’s Other Uses: Learn where else Swift is used (such as competitive programming & online contest sites)11. Prepare for iOS Job Interview: Curated interview questions to assist you in preparing for iOS App Developer Job InterviewExtra: Standard Resume Making Tips and Sample Resume to apply for iOS Developer Jobs

Overview
Section 1: Introduction

Lecture 1 Introducing Apple’s Swift Programming Language

Section 2: Apple’s UI Frameworks: UIKit and SwiftUI

Lecture 2 A Comparative Study on UIKit and SwiftUI

Section 3: Tour of Xcode: Apple’s IDE

Lecture 3 Exploring Xcode Options

Section 4: Conditional in the Swift Programming Language

Lecture 4 Set Conditionals & Logic

Section 5: Data Types in the Swift Programming Language

Lecture 5 Swift’s Data Types

Section 6: Variables, Constants, Functions & Guard in the Swift Programming Language

Lecture 6 Custom Functions, Variables, Constants & Guard Statement

Section 7: Events & Actions

Lecture 7 Perform Actions & Events

Section 8: Buttons in Swift

Lecture 8 Implement Five Different Buttons

Section 9: TabView, Images & Assets

Lecture 9 Assets, Images & TabView

Section 10: Text, TextField & Menu

Lecture 10 Menu, TextField & Text

Section 11: Design Stacks: VStack, HStack & ZStack

Lecture 11 Implementing Stacks to Hold Widgets

Section 12: Video Player (Offline)

Lecture 12 Playing Videos without Internet

Section 13: Video Player (Online)

Lecture 13 Playing Online Videos

Section 14: Space, Padding, Foreground & Background Colors

Lecture 14 Foreground & Background Colors, Space and Padding

Section 15: Understanding API: Application Programming Interface

Lecture 15 What is an API and what do APIs do?

Section 16: API Integration: How Model, View & ViewModel or Service Interact

Lecture 16 How API’s function along with the Model, View, ViewModel & Service

Section 17: Project: Meeting Notes iOS Mobile App

Lecture 17 Starting Project with CoreData

Lecture 18 To structure a Data Model and prepare the features

Lecture 19 Adding & Deleting Custom Notes Offline

Lecture 20 Polishing UI and Updating App

Lecture 21 Preparing Note Format

Lecture 22 Data Controller

Lecture 23 Updating UI

Section 18: Testing Live API Response

Lecture 24 Testing API Response using Postman

Section 19: Initiating New Xcode Project

Lecture 25 New Project Generation using Xcode

Section 20: Project Space Flight iOS App

Lecture 26 Testing Space Flight News API Response using Postman and Preparing Model Class

Lecture 27 Coding the Home Screen

Lecture 28 Service to Fetch Data

Lecture 29 Polishing UI

Lecture 30 Coding the Details Screen and Routing

Section 21: Project Photo Gallery iOS App

Lecture 31 Exploring and Testing Unsplash API Response using Postman and Browser

Lecture 32 Splash Screen and App Icon Setting

Lecture 33 Polishing UI

Lecture 34 Preparing the Service to Fetch & Display Photos in Grid View

Lecture 35 Data Model Class and API Key

Lecture 36 GridView of Photos and Responsive UI

Lecture 37 Details Screen and Photo Sharing

Section 22: Advanced Swift: DispatchQueue & Background Thread

Lecture 38 DispatchQueue, Main & Background Thread

Section 23: Project Firebase

Lecture 39 Understanding and Configuring Firebase into iOS Projects

Section 24: Archive & Build iOS Project

Lecture 40 To archive and build an Xcode iOS Project

Section 25: Job Interview Preparation Questions

Lecture 41 iOS Job Interview Important Questions

Section 26: Extra: Standard Resume Format and Tips

Lecture 42 Sample Standard iOS Developer Resume with Tips

If you are a beginner or student, take this course,If you want to switch from Objective-C to Swift, take this course,If you want to move from UIKit to SwiftUI, take this course,If you are a programmer or developer intending to learn Apple’s latest iOS App Development, take this course


Password/解压密码www.tbtos.com

资源下载此资源仅限VIP下载,请先

转载请注明:0daytown » Ios App Development Using Swift With Ios Mobile App Projects

您必须 登录 才能发表评论!